England after dominating their group in the Super-12 stage will be facing Blackcaps in the first semi-final of T20 World Cup 2021. New Zealand after losing their very first game to Pakistan have ended up winning 4 games in a row, while England look like an unbeatable side at this moment considering their recent form.

Jason Roy's absence might hurt the English side but they still have got a lot of match winners like Jos Buttler, Jonny Bairstow, Moeen Ali, Liam Livingstone, Chris Woakes and Adil Rashid. England is expected to start as favourites in this clash against New Zealand.

Last time when these two sides faced each other in 2016 T20 World Cup semi-finals, England ended up winning the game convincingly by 7 wickets. Last time when these two teams played against each other in an ICC event, it ended up being a very controversial game as England ended up winning 2019 World Cup finals by the barest of margin, even after the Super Over got tied with the help of boundary count rule.

Notably, in T20 World Cup England lead New Zealand by 3-2 margin in head-to-head count.

Numbers and stats before start of England vs New Zealand game:

1 - Jonny Bairstow needs 1 more six to complete 50 sixes in T20Is.

Most sixes by batsman for England in T20Is:

Eoin Morgan - 119
Jos Buttler - 90
Jason Roy - 59
Alex Hales - 55
Jonny Bairstow - 49

2 - Both England and New Zealand have reached semi-finals of T20 World Cup twice in the past. England have won both the semi-final match that they have played in T20 World Cups, while New Zealand have never won a semi-final match in T20 World Cup so far.

England in T20 World Cup semi-finals:

2010 - Defeated Sri Lanka by 7 wickets
2016 - Defeated New Zealand by 7 wickets

New Zealand in T20 World Cup semi-finals:

2007 - Lost to Pakistan by 6 wickets
2016 - Lost to England by 7 wickets

3 - Tim Southee needs 3 more wickets to become New Zealand's highest wicket-taker in T20 WC overall.

Most wickets for New Zealand in T20 WC:

Nathan McCullum - 23
Tim Southee - 21
Daniel Vettori -20

10 - Jos Buttler needs just 10 more runs to become highest run-scorer for England in a single T20 WC edition.

Most runs for England in single T20 WC edition:

Joe Root - 249 in 2016
Kevin Pietersen - 248 in 2010
Jos Buttler - 240 in 2021

11 - Trent Boult has taken 11 wickets in T20 WC 2021 so far, which has been joint-most for any New Zealand bowler in single T20 WC series.

Most wickets by a New Zealand bowler in single T20 WC edition:

Daniel Vettori - 11 wickets in 2007
Trent Boult - 11 wickets in 2021
Mitchell Santner/ Ish Sodhi - 10 wickets in 2016

36 - Jos Buttler needs 36 more runs to surpass Kevin Pietersen (580) and become the leading run-scorer for England in T20 World Cup. Eoin Morgan is also in contention to become England's leading run-scorer in T20 World Cup.

Most runs for England in T20 World Cup:

Kevin Pietersen - 580
Eoin Morgan - 548
Jos Buttler - 545
